Osborne Clarke advises AerFin's management team on sale to ORIX Aviation

Published on 3 September 2026

International legal practice Osborne Clarke has advised the senior management team of AerFin, a leading aviation services business, on the proposed sale, subject to receipt of regulatory approvals, of AerFin to ORIX Aviation, a global aircraft leasing, asset management and investment platform. 

This transaction demonstrates Osborne Clarke's strength in private equity transactions and complex international M&A, and in particular highlights the expertise of our specialist Management Advisory Group in protecting the interests of the senior team both on the transaction itself, and in respect of their continuing role in the business.  

AerFin buys, sells, leases and repairs aircraft, engines and parts, and is a trusted partner in the global aviation aftermarket. Its flexible services – from trading and inventory solutions to leasing and repairs – help airlines, lessors and maintenance providers manage their fleets more effectively.
